Set Up Your Tracking System Efficiently

Start by choosing a reliable GMB performance dashboard that consolidates your Google My Business data, reviews, and ranking insights. I remember the first time I integrated a comprehensive dashboard; it felt like switching from a flashlight to floodlights—suddenly I saw the whole picture clearly.

Connect Your Data Sources

Link your Google Analytics, Google Search Console, and Maps Analytics to your dashboard. This creates a unified view of your local search performance, keyword rankings, and customer interactions. Think of it like assembling a puzzle—each piece is essential to see the full image of your local SEO health.

Set Up Tracking Metrics and KPIs

Identify key performance indicators such as local pack rankings, click-through rates, reviews, and Google Maps views. Use a KPI dashboard to monitor these in real-time. I once neglected to track review volume, which led to a sudden ranking drop; once I added review count to my KPIs, I caught issues early and responded proactively.

Schedule Regular Checks and Updates

Consistency is critical. Schedule weekly or bi-weekly reviews of your dashboards. Use these sessions to identify patterns, spikes, or dips in rankings. Treat these checks like a health monitor—regular, systematic, and attentive.

Use Alerts to Stay Alert

Configure automated alerts for significant changes in rankings or review counts. This way, you’re immediately informed of potential issues, rather than discovering them days later. I once received an alert about a sudden ranking drop caused by a duplicated listing; acting swiftly restored my visibility within days.

Analyze and Adjust Your Strategy

Leverage the data to refine your local SEO tactics. For example, if a particular keyword drops in rank, investigate related reviews, on-page signals, or NAP consistency. Use insights from Maps Analytics to identify gaps and opportunities.

Document Your Progress

Keep a log of your metrics over time. This helps you understand what strategies work best and provides a baseline for future improvements. Remember, local SEO is a marathon, not a sprint, and tracking your progress keeps you motivated and informed.

Why Do People Overlook the Nuance of Data Quality?

A common myth is that any tracking is better than no tracking at all. However, not all data sources are created equal. Relying solely on Google Rankings or basic keyword checks can give you a misleading picture of your actual performance. For instance, rankings can fluctuate due to localized search variations or personalized search results, which don’t necessarily reflect real-world visibility. Instead, integrating multiple data points through a comprehensive GMB performance dashboard ensures you’re capturing a true picture of your local SEO health.

Furthermore, data quality matters—incorrect NAP (Name, Address, Phone number) information, inconsistent reviews, or outdated contact details can skew your analytics, leading to misguided strategies. The key is to maintain data consistency across all sources and leverage tools like Maps Analytics that help identify discrepancies before they impact your rankings.

Beware of the Trap of Over-Tracking

Another mistake is obsessively tracking every possible metric without context. It’s tempting to monitor everything from click-through rates to review volume, but this can become overwhelming and counterproductive. Instead, focus on a well-designed KPI dashboard that highlights your most meaningful metrics. Over-tracking can lead to analysis paralysis, where you spend more time interpreting data than acting on it.
